摘要
本文测试了5Cr2NiMoV钢的室温和高温力学性能,探讨了热处理工艺对性能的影响,并与5CrNiMo钢的性能做了对比。结果表明,5Cr2NiMoV钢由于存在二次硬化效应,其回火抗力和高温强度高于5CrNiMo钢。还指出5Cr2NiMo钢存在中温脆性,提高回火温度可以降低中温脆性的危害。
The mechanical properties of steel 5Cr2NiMoV at room and elevated temperature were measured. The influence of heat treatment on the properties was also investigated, and the comparison of the properties between 5Cr2NiMoV and 5CrNiMo was made. The results show that the tempering resistance and strength at elevated temperature of 5Cr2NiMoV steel are higher than that of 5Cr2NiMoV steel, owing to its secondary hardening effect. It is pointed out that there exsits medium temperature embrittlement in 5Cr2NiMoV steel and its detriment may be reduced by increasing the tempering temperature.
